Linear programming is discussed in this article. We will learn about this after reading this article. Linear Programming 2 has a meaning. Linear Programming is a mathematical technique for the analysis of optimum decisions subject to certain constraints in the form of linear inequalities.
It applies to the maximization or minimization problems that have a system of linear inequalities stated in terms of certain variables.

Linear programming can be used for a system of linear constraints and a linear objective function. The goal of linear programming is to find the values of the variables that maximize or minimize the objective function.
The objective function and the constraints appear as linear functions of the decision variables in the solution of problems. Equalities or inequalities are possible in the constraint equations.
